JERKY TURKEY BURGERS WITH PAPAYA SALSA

Categories     Poultry

Time 30m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 21

1 1/3 lbs ground turkey breast
1 garlic clove, minced
2 scallions, thinly sliced
1 serrano peppers or 1 jalapeno pepper, seeded and minced
1 inch gingerroot, grated
2 teaspoons fresh thyme leaves, a few sprigs, leaves stripped and chopped
1 teaspoon allspice, eyeball the amount
1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
1 teaspoon coarse black pepper
coarse salt
extra virgin olive oil or vegetable oil, for drizzling
1 ripe lime, juice of
4 lettuce leaves
4 kaiser rolls, split
1 large ripe papaya, seeded, peeled and diced
1/2 red bell pepper, seeded and diced
1/4 red onion, finely chopped
1 jalapeno pepper, seeded and finely chopped
2 tablespoons fresh cilantro leaves, finely chopped
1 navel orange, juice of
coarse salt

Steps:

  • Preheat a large nonstick skillet, indoor grill pan or tabletop grill to medium high heat. Combine the turkey, garlic, scallions, ginger, thyme, allspice, nutmeg, salt and pepper in a medium bowl.
  • Form mixture into 4 large patties no more than 1-inch thick. Drizzle the patties with a touch of oil.
  • Place patties in a hot pan or on a hot grill and cook 6 minutes on each side.
  • Squeeze the juice of 1 ripe lime over the patties before removing them from the heat. Place the cooked patties on bun bottoms and top with lettuce leaves.
  • Combine the papaya, red bell pepper, red onion, serrano or jalapeno, cilantro and orange juice in a bowl. Season salsa with salt, to your taste.
  • Pile salsa on top of the lettuce resting on cooked patties and add bun tops to the burgers. Serve with Chili Lime Avocados and pineapple wedges.

JAMAICAN JERK TURKEY BURGERS WITH TROPICAL FRUIT SALSA



Jamaican Jerk Turkey Burgers With Tropical Fruit Salsa image

This is a Weight Watchers recipe. Its a delicous alternative to hamburgers. The salsa adds a slightly sweet touch to tame the heat of the jerk seasoning. The salsa can be prepared up to one day in advance and refrigerated until ready to use.

Categories     < 60 Mins

Time 45m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 cup papaya, diced
1 cup mango, diced
3/4 cup red onion, finely chopped
1/2 cup green pepper, finely chopped
2 tablespoons cilantro, fresh, chopped
2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1/2 cup quick oats, uncooked
1/3 cup ketchup
1 tablespoon caribbean jerk seasoning
1 egg
1 lb lean ground turkey

Steps:

  • To prepare salsa, in a medium bowl, combine papaya, mango, 1/4 cup of red onion and 14/ cup green pepper, cilantro and lime juice. Set aside.
  • To prepare burgers, in a large bowl, combine remaining 1/2 cup red onion, remaining 1/4 cup of green pepper, oats, ketchup, jerk seasoning and egg and mix well. Add turkey; mix thouroughly. Shape turkey into four 1 inch thich patties; cover and refrigerate for a minimum of 20 minutes.
  • Preheat broiler. Broil burgers until cooked through, flipping once, about 20-25 minutes total. Serve each bruger topped with about a heaping 1/3 cup of salsa.

JAMAICAN JERK TURKEY BURGERS WITH PAPAYA-MANGO SALSA



Jamaican Jerk Turkey Burgers With Papaya-Mango Salsa image

This is from Cooking Light Times are approximate Posting for safe keeping. Make sure to oil the bugers and grill. Make salsa early in the day or the night before for the flavours to meld.

Categories     Poultry

Time 45m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 16

2/3 cup diced peeled papaya
2/3 cup diced peeled mango
1/4 cup finely chopped red bell pepper
1/4 cup finely chopped red onion
2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
1/2 teaspoon grated lime rind
2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1 cup finely chopped red onion
1/2 cup dry breadcrumbs
1/3 cup bottled sweet and sour sauce
1/4 cup finely chopped red bell pepper
1 tablespoon jamaican jerk seasoning (such as Spice Islands)
1 large egg white
1 lb ground turkey
cooking spray
4 (2 ounce) kaiser rolls or 4 (2 ounce) hamburger buns

Steps:

  • For the salsa:.
  • Combine papaya, mango, red pepper, red onion, cilantro, lime rind and juice.
  • Let stand at room temperature at least 30 minutes before serving.
  • Prepare grill to medium heat.
  • For the burgers:.
  • Combine 1 cup onion , breadcrumbs, sweet and sour sauce, red pepper,jerk seasoning,and egg white. Stir well.
  • Add turkey; mix well to combine.
  • Divide turkey mixture into 4 equal portions, shaping each into a 1-inch-thick patty. Cover and refrigerate 20 minutes.
  • Lightly coat patties with cooking spray; place on a grill rack coated with cooking spray. Grill 7 minutes on each side or until done.
  • Cut rolls in half horizontally.
  • Place rolls, cut sides down, on grill rack; grill 1 minute or until lightly toasted.
  • Place 1 patty on bottom half of each roll; top with 1/2 cup salsa and top half of roll.
